Shot this buck in Va. Saturday afternoon. Buck was trailing hard and I took shot at about 100 yards in last opening. As I came out of stand bottom fell out. I found a spot of blood and marked it. Not sure of the shot I discussed with my son and decided we would let lay for the night. It rained all night and continued into the morning.

And about 10 that morning the rain stopped. My son met me at the farm with JAKE. Jake has been part of the family since a puppy. I used him a lot when he was young. But last few years I backed off his training. I would just track deer myself. Basically just too lazy to go get him on deer I knew where hit good.

I knew this would be a true test. 16 hours later with little break in rain. Within 10 mins on ground Jake had us with deer. He was pulling so hard I told my son I felt a deer must have just came through the area. But I had no choice but to trust him. Glad I did.
